Timber Resource Management and Legality Licensing Regulations, 2017 (L.I. 2254)

Regulation 39—Application for licence
 (1) A person who intends to export a timber product from the country or distribute a timber product for sale on the domestic market shall apply in writing to the Commission.
 (2) The application shall be made in the format determined by the Commission.
 (3) An application for a licence may be made to cover 
 (a) the shipment of a timber product destined for export from the country; and
 (b) the consignment of a timber product harvested within the country or a timber product destined for sale on the domestic market.
 (4) An application shall be accompanied with the documentation required by the Commission.
 (5) An applicant shall submit the application with the administrative and processing fee prescribed by the Commission under the Fees and Charges (Miscellaneous Provisions) Act, 2009 (Act 793).
